C+
67/100
It's a nice place to work
Review from Operations Dept
We have great staff. A diverse group of skills and personalities
nothing at all is positive.
We all love each other as friends
The fun my coworkers and I have
Review from Product Dept
Everyone interacts like a family, new or old.
More positive comments in reference to a job that’s well done
Review from Product Dept